B-Pro, Fort Loudon, Largemouth, 5-18, Frank
#1
We got to the canal ramp close to 6 this morning. Started out on loudon with topwater and had three lm. Then we switch to a bandit crankbait and started catching alot more fish. Fish the crankbait throughout the day and ended up with about 25 lm (5 keepers). We located a school lm on a flat in 45 ft and caught them for about an hour. All of them were short but one and it went about 2 lbs and they all were caught on a C-rig. Next we went flipping back in turkey creek and end up with ten lm and 4 were keepers. Are five best would have went 8-9 lbs. Water was stained and 68 to 72. Not a bad day on the lake and end got off the water around 4pm.
